This monitor needs a little setting up for some use cases. You probably didn't have HDR set up correctly. I had your issue really bad until I turned on HDR in windows and set the monitor to HDR too, I also had to play with the RGB range (0-256 etc.) on both windows and the monitor aswell. It also has an light detection feature BI+ , where if you are working in low light it dims the screen (and this is automatically on for many of the pre-sets), you need this turned off too if it's always too dim (or randomly changing as you are using it, like mine did at first ... I was so confused lol). If you are using this monitor for graphical work however, I would suggest not to, as to really get it dialled you do have to do some funky stuff, and it's never quite 100% colour accurate, but for gaming etc. just stick on HDR and it's very close to colour accurate with some minor tuning and can look really amazing.
